Overview

Reinforced composite pipes are engineered by combining thermoplastic polymers (e.g., HDPE, PVC) with high-strength fibers like glass or carbon. This hybrid design leverages the corrosion resistance of plastics and the mechanical strength of reinforcements, making them suitable for demanding environments. They are increasingly replacing metal pipes in sectors requiring lightweight, durable, and cost-effective solutions. Originally developed for aerospace and automotive industries, these pipes now dominate municipal and industrial applications due to their adaptability. Their layered construction often includes an inner liner for smooth fluid flow, a reinforcement layer for load-bearing, and an outer protective coating.

Structure and Working Principle

The pipe typically consists of three layers: an inner liner, a reinforcement layer, and an outer jacket. The inner liner ensures chemical resistance and smooth flow, while the middle layer (woven fibers or helical wraps) provides tensile strength. The outer layer protects against abrasion and environmental factors. Under pressure, the reinforcement layer absorbs stress, preventing deformation. Unlike metal pipes, composites resist electrolytic corrosion and scaling, reducing maintenance. Advanced designs may include aluminum or aramid fibers for specialized requirements, such as high-temperature resistance or impact tolerance.

Key Features

Lightweight yet robust, reinforced composite pipes weigh up to 70% less than steel equivalents, simplifying transport and installation. Their flexibility allows for trenchless laying techniques, minimizing excavation costs. The non-conductive nature eliminates stray current corrosion risks. These pipes also exhibit low thermal conductivity, reducing heat loss in hot fluid applications. Manufacturers often customize wall thickness and fiber orientation to meet specific pressure ratings (commonly 10–25 bar). UV-stabilized variants are available for above-ground use.

Application Areas

Municipal water and wastewater systems widely adopt these pipes due to their leak-proof joints and longevity (50+ years). In industrial settings, they transport acids, alkalis, and slurries without degradation. Oil and gas sectors use them for offshore brine lines and chemical injection. Agriculture benefits from their lightweight drip irrigation systems. Firefighting networks utilize their burst resistance. Recent innovations include smart pipes with embedded sensors for real-time pressure monitoring.

Maintenance and Precautions

Routine inspections should focus on joint integrity and surface damage. Abrasive media may require thicker liners or ceramic coatings. Avoid mechanical impacts during handling, as cracks in the outer layer can expose fibers to moisture. For underground installation, ensure proper bedding material to prevent point loads. Chemical compatibility charts must be consulted when transporting aggressive fluids. Thermal expansion (0.1–0.2 mm/m°C) requires allowance in fixed piping systems.

B2B Procurement Guide

Buyers should verify third-party certifications like ISO 14692 (composite pipes) and NSF/ANSI 61 for potable water. MOQ varies by supplier, but bulk orders (500+ meters) often attract 10–15% discounts. Lead times range from 2–8 weeks for customized diameters. Partner with manufacturers offering technical support for jointing methods (e.g., electrofusion, flange adapters). Sample testing for pressure cycling and chemical resistance is recommended. Incoterms like CIP or DDP are preferable for international shipments to mitigate logistics risks.
